The future of our iron ore
Mesabi Metallics will power up a new mine and taconite production plant over at Nashwauk in
February of 2026. This modern, state of the art facility will begin by producing premium “Direct
Reduction” pellets that are compatible with the efficient steel furnaces that are replacing the
last of the out of date, inefficient, polluting furnaces in the Rust Belt.
